Summary
- Dr. Jonathan Jagid is a neurosurgeon in Miami, FL and is affiliated with multiple hospitals in the area, including Jackson Health System, University of Miami Hospital, Miami Veterans Affairs Healthcare System, and University of Miami Hospital and Clinics. He received his medical degree from New York Medical College and has been in practice 23 years. He is experienced in stereotactic and functional surgery, neurosurgical trauma and critical care, and epilepsy surgery.
